Summary

On World Mental Health Day, Gary Brecka discusses how the food you eat impacts your mental health and why you need to ditch ultra-processed foods NOW! He reveals research showing that people who consume ultra-processed foods are 33% more likely to develop depression, emphasizing the detrimental effects these foods have on our gut microbiome and overall mental state.
